WebMar 16, 2024 · Okonkwo is frustrated by Nwoye because he reminds him so much of his own father, Unoka. Okonkwo is disappointed that Nwoye resembles Unoka in that he’s sensitive and often lazy. Okonkwo views these as signs of femininity which he believes is one of the most disgraceful traits an Ibo man can display. From the start, Okonkwo 's will seems to drive his ascent in Umuofia society. He rises from being the son of a debtor to being one of the leaders of the clan, thanks to his hard work and aggression.

Okonkwo's unbalanced chi is result of his childhood and need to be the opposite of his father. He lacks the feminine part of his chi, while his father lacked the more masculine part of his chi.
